#77d96f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#77d96f is composed of 46.7% red, 85.1% green and 43.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 48.8%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 115.5 degrees, a saturation of 58.2% and a lightness of 64.3%. #77d96f color hex could be obtained by blending #eeffde with #00b300.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

Shades and Tints of #77d96f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040b03 is the darkest color, while #fbfef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#77d96f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a1a8a0 is the less saturated color, while #59fc4c is the most saturated one.
